Other Events. ------------- AlliedSignal Inc. issued a press release on January 28, 1998 reporting the following results for operations for the three- month and twelve-month periods ending December 31, 1997. AlliedSignal Inc. Consolidated Statement of Income (In millions except per share amounts) (Unaudited) TWELVE MONTHS ENDED DECEMBER 31 ---------------------- 1997 1996 ---- ---- Net sales $14,472 $13,971 ------- ------- Cost of goods sold 11,481(A) 11,606(C) Selling, general and administrative expenses 1,581 1,511 Gain on sale of business (226)(B) (655)(D) ------- ------- Total costs and expenses 12,836 2,462 ------- ------- Income from operations 1,636 1,509 Equity in income of affiliated companies 178 (A) 143 Other income (expense) 77 87 (C) Interest and other financial charges (175) (186) ------- ------- Income before taxes on income 1,716 1,553 Taxes on income 546 533 ------- ------- Net Income $1,170 $1,020 ======= ====== Earnings per share of common stock-basic (E) $2.07 $1.80 ===== ===== Earnings per share of common stock - assuming dilution (E) $2.02 $1.76 ===== ===== Weighted average number of shares outstanding-basic (E) 565 566 ===== ===== Weighted average number of shares outstanding-assuming dilution (E) 580 580 ===== ===== (A) Cost of goods sold includes a provision of $237 million for repositioning and other charges. A charge of $13 million relating to the writedown of an equity investment is included in equity in income of affiliated companies. Total pretax repositioning and other charges were $250 million (after-tax $159 million, or $0.28 per share). (B) Includes the fourth quarter pretax gain of $277 million (after-tax $196 million, or $0.35 per share) on the sale of the automotive safety restraints business effective November 1, 1997. Also includes a charge of $51 million (after-tax $33 million, or $0.06 per share) related to the settlement of the 1996 braking business sale. (C) Cost of goods sold includes a second quarter provision of $637 million for repositioning and other charges. An offsetting credit of $15 million representing the minority interest share of repositioning and other charges is included in other income (expense). Total pretax repositioning and other charges were $622 million (after-tax $359 million, or $0.63 per share). (D) Represents the second quarter pretax gain (after-tax $368 million, or $0.65 per share) on the sale of the hydraulic braking and anti-lock braking systems business effective April 1, 1996. (E) Effective in the fourth quarter of 1997 the Company implemented FASB No. 128 which establishes new requirements for computing and presenting earnings per share and requires the disclosure of basic and diluted earnings per share. The prior year earnings per share data has been recalculated to reflect the provisions of FASB No. 128. Share and per share data for all periods reflect the September 1997 two-for-one stock split.
